Accountant - Assumption College 

Assumption College is a vibrant Marist community located just 30 minutes north of Melbourne’s northern suburbs. The College is recognised for its innovative and engaging approaches to contemporary learning and wellbeing. We educate more than 1,500 students from Years 7 to 12 and offer boarding for up to 70 students.

We are seeking an Accountant to join the team who will play a vital role in supporting the effective financial stewardship of Assumption College by delivering accurate, timely and reliable financial information. You will work under the direction of the Finance Manager and contribute to the day-to-day operations of the Colleges financial processes. This is a full time, ongoing position but part time hours may be considered

Responsibilities include:

  • Financial transaction processing and reconciliations
  • Financial reporting and month-end support
  • Asset management
  • Compliance with policies, procedures and legislative requirement
  • Provision of high-quality customer service to internal and external stakeholders
  • Contribution to process improvement and best-practice financial management
Join a team that is a welcoming community built on family spirit with a shared purpose. Benefits include, staff social club, membership to Kilmore Golf Club, after hours use of the onsite fitness centre and much more. 
Applications close Monday 13th April 2026, suitable applicants will be contacted prior to the closing date. All enquiries can be directed to HR Manager at HR@assumption.vic.edu.au
